Abstract
An integrated electromagnetic interference (EMI) filter circuit with electrostatic discharge (ESD) protection and incorporating capacitors is provided. At least one passive element, i.e. resistor or inductor is connected between an input terminal and an output terminal. A first capacitor is connected between ground and the input terminal, and a second capacitor is connected between ground and the output terminal. A first diode and a second diode are connected in parallel to the first capacitor and the second capacitor. One or multiple parallel capacitors are connected in parallel to the passive element and between the input terminal and the output terminal for frequency compensation by employing the novel EMI LPF circuit, it is extraordinarily advantageous of enhancing its rejection band attenuation and meanwhile maintaining high cut-off frequency while implementation.
